Claw World, the luxury claw machine boutique, marked its flagship grand opening in Las Vegas’ Chinatown district on Spring Mountain Road, drawing over 1,500 attendees. The event, held April 14, 2026, signals a notable shift in the 'attention economy' by blending traditional arcade gaming with the global designer toy market, as announced in a press release.
The flagship location, designed as a 'social-media-first' space, features neon-industrial accents and lush floral archways, creating an immersive backdrop for influencers. A unique 'trade-up' prize system allows players to swap wins for limited-edition collectibles, enhancing the experience. Over $80,000 in luxury prizes and designer toys were awarded during the two-day celebration.
The grand opening integrated cultural elements, including traditional lion dances and live hosting by media personalities, emphasizing the brand’s commitment to local Chinatown heritage. The location serves as a primary hub for rare 'blind box' releases and jumbo-sized plushies that are frequently sold out nationwide, according to the release.
